Output 73d77d7b752ab41c276a1e3464aa607a19ef003cc672a282985ea0d273c2804e:0

value
620643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 289febc60d788eb0bdcd64b38db35dc0981aa83b OP_EQUAL
address
35PpXiqmEgocSjScCkbA67i5Ujj92hBjP2
transaction
73d77d7b752ab41c276a1e3464aa607a19ef003cc672a282985ea0d273c2804e
confirmations
223319
spent
true